Overnight Blueberry French Toast Casserole Recipe

- Prep Time: 20 minutes
- Cook Time: 75 minutes
- Total Time: 8 hours 45 minutes
- Yield: 8 servings 1x

Cream Cheese Mixture:
- 1 pack (8 ounces) softened cream cheese
- 1 cup powdered sugar
- 2 tablespoons milk
- 1 tablespoon vanilla extract, split
- 1 cup blueberries
Bread Layers:
- 2 loaves cubed french bread (separated)
Egg Mixture:
- 2 cups milk
- 8 eggs
- 1 teaspoon cinnamon powder
- 1/2 teaspoon ground nutmeg
- 1 cup blueberries
- Step 1: Prepare the Cream Cheese Mixture
In a bowl, mix together the softened cream cheese, confectioners’ sugar, milk, and vanilla extract until smooth. Gently fold in blueberries.
- Step 2: Assemble the Bread Layers
Layer cubed french bread in a baking dish, spread cream cheese mixture, add remaining bread cubes.
- Step 3: Prepare and Add the Egg Mixture
Whisk together milk, eggs, vanilla extract, cinnamon, and nutmeg. Pour over bread, add blueberries. Refrigerate overnight.
- Step 4: Preheat the Oven
Preheat oven to 375°F (190°C).
- Step 5: Bake the Dish
Bake covered for 45 minutes, then uncovered until set and browned, approximately 30 minutes more.
- Step 6: Serve and Enjoy
Cool slightly before serving. Enjoy your creamy blueberry French toast casserole!
